Transferring domestic worker salaries via the Musaned platform: Steps and conditions

The Ministry of Human Resources and Social Development in Saudi Arabia continues its digital efforts to regulate the recruitment sector and facilitate financial transactions between employers and domestic workers. As part of this initiative, the “Musaned” platform offers an electronic service for transferring domestic worker salaries , a step aimed at enhancing transparency and safeguarding the rights of both parties by officially documenting all financial transactions within the platform.
The context of digital transformation and wage protection in the Kingdom
The launch of these digital services is part of the Kingdom's Vision 2030, which aims to digitize all government and private services to enhance efficiency and streamline procedures. Historically, the domestic worker sector has relied heavily on cash transactions, sometimes leading to labor disputes over salary payments or delays. Therefore, the "Wage Protection Program" for domestic workers represents a significant shift in regulating contractual relationships. The Ministry has mandated that employers document wage payments through approved digital channels, ensuring a safe and stable working environment for all.
Conditions for transferring domestic worker salaries via Musaned
To benefit from the domestic worker salary transfer correctly, the employer must meet a set of basic requirements that ensure the process is successfully reflected within the Musaned platform:
- The employer must have an active and verified account on the Musaned platform.
- The employer's profile data must be complete and fully up-to-date.
- Domestic workers must be officially registered under the sponsorship of the employer.
- The domestic worker must have a valid residency permit within the Kingdom.
Steps for transferring salaries and viewing them in detail
Employers can easily complete the transfer process and view the financial details by following these steps:
First: Transfer steps (outside the Musaned platform)
- Log in to the approved e-wallet or the employer's banking application.
- Go to the services menu and select the “Domestic Worker Salaries” service.
- Identify the domestic worker to whom the salary is to be transferred.
- Enter the amount and confirm the transfer to send it directly to the worker's account.
Second: Steps to view salaries (within the Musaned platform)
- Log in to the Musaned electronic platform.
- Click on the “Employment” option from the main menu of the site.
- Select the domestic worker whose financial transaction record you wish to review.
- Click on the “View Details” option.
- From the salary details, click on the “View” icon to see all documented transfers.
The local and international impact of regulating domestic worker wages
The importance of this digital system extends beyond simply facilitating daily transactions; it encompasses far-reaching positive impacts at the local, regional, and international levels. Locally, these steps contribute to reducing labor disputes and conflicts related to wages to their lowest levels, thus enhancing social and security stability. Regionally and internationally, these initiatives improve Saudi Arabia's ranking in human rights and human trafficking indices, and reaffirm its commitment to international labor standards and the protection of migrant workers' rights. Furthermore, providing additional services such as "insurance for domestic worker contracts" ensures compensation for all parties involved in the contractual relationship in the event of any unforeseen circumstances, making the Saudi labor market a globally attractive and reliable environment.
Services available for domestic workers through Musaned
In addition to the services provided to the employer, the Musaned platform allows domestic workers to directly benefit from several important features, most notably:
- View and browse the details of the notarized employment contract at any time.
- Submitting complaints and reports and following up on the actions taken regarding them electronically.
- Receive instant updates and notifications regarding contractual and financial status.
